Counterfactuals Counterfactuals grade decisions that were NOT executed — expired queues, no-chase rules, untaken optional trims — against what the market then did. They are kept strictly separate from the calibration cells above.
What the decisions we didn't take would have done.
- No-chase queue (queued a pullback instead of chasing) — 4 cases , median would-have 1W move +1.8% → verdict: cost
- Optional trims not taken — 26 cases , median would-have 1W move +2.5% → verdict: saved
- Anticipate slot (pre-breakout buy-stop) — 1 case → verdict: n/a
Counterfactuals are advisory evidence for the book's learnings reviews — never blended into the calibration cells.
